The Gearhead
Englewood, NJ
Ferraris, Lamborghinis, Aston Martins, Bentleys, Corvettes and more. Gotham Car’s Dream Tour is the chance to get behind the wheel of six different exotics steeds and hit the open country roads.

The Oh Captain, My Captain
Manhattan
For any man that has dreamt of taking to the sea. The legendary Offshore Sailing School offers two-, three- and five-day accelerated sailing certification courses and a race-ready course for the experienced mariner.

The Literary Lunch
Manhattan
At one time or another, everyone’s been guilty of flipping through the New Yorker to read all the cartoons first. With good reason — they’re the droll, ironic poets laureate of the funnies world. This experience takes a tour behind the scenes of the New Yorker office followed by a lunch with cartoon editor Bob Mankoff. Pro tip: ask him about the cartoons that didn’t get published. You won’t be disappointed.

The Sky’s the Limit
Westchester, NY
In a day’s time, you’ll go from ground instruction to grabbing the reins yourself with Wing Air’s helicopter flight lessons along the NYC skyline. No prior experience necessary, and includes a gratis passenger.

The Speed Demon
New York
Those with heart conditions: go ahead and skip this one. Because you and dad are going to be fighter pilots for the day. Suit up, strap in and take a deep breath. With Air Combat’s Training Program, you’ll learn basic show-off maneuvers within the first flight session. By round two, you’ll be encountering real-life tactical situations.

The Bucket List
Antarctica
Take a trip to Antarctica, where you’ll be heli-skiing on unexplored slopes with Himalayan Heliski Guides. It’s 12 nights and 11 days of adventure from Argentina to the polar zone and back. Calling it a bonding experience would be an understatement. Only serious thrillseekers need apply.
